Juliet C/C++ 1.0 Test suite #25
DownloadDescription
A collection of test cases in the C/C++ language. It contains examples for 116 different CWEs. This software is not subject to copyright protection and is in the public domain. NIST assumes no responsibility whatsoever for its use by other parties, and makes no guaranties, expressed or implied, about its quality, reliability, or any other characteristic.
